THE village of Heringworth was certainly " invasion-conscious." It was the job of John Garstairs to see that it was so. He was the Chairman of the village Invasion Committee and had summoned the meeting to discuss how Heringworth should deal with the Hun. How Death itself invaded that meeting and thereby staged a first-rate mystery is the theme of this very fine novel by that ever popular storyteller, John Rhode. |
